Management Meeting Minutes — Halverton Group

Attendees: Priya Tindall, Marcus Oborne, Lena Quist. Priya walked us through the term sheet from Braxley Partners. Headline numbers look decent, though Marcus flagged the exclusivity clause as too broad for our Westmoor branches. Lena will push back on the 18-month lock-in before Friday. Branch managers: please don't discuss this with staff yet — nothing is signed. We'll circulate a summary once terms firm up. The strategic context is below.

internal memo for bahap-yagug: Headcount on the Ulaix team goes from 3 to 100 by the end of January. Gross margin on Ulaix came in at 10 percent against a plan of 15 percent.

# Pricing — Managers Only: Harlock Series

List pricing for the Harlock Series holds through Q4. Branch discretion: up to 8% discount on orders above 200 units; anything beyond needs regional approval. Do not quote bundle pricing until the revised sheet lands. Competitor undercutting in the Velden territory is being monitored. The confidential pricing strategy note follows below.

confidential, bahap-bajog: Zorethix Works is in early talks to buy Kelethox Foods for about $30.7 million. The Ralvan launch date is September 19, and nothing goes to the press before then.

Ticket: THM-914 — Thumbnail queue workers failing auth

All Pixelbarn thumbnail workers stopped pulling jobs at 02:10; service credentials expired. Queue backlog hit 40k before rotation. New credentials issued and verified on two workers; full fleet rollout today. For the sync: workers authenticate to the internal queue broker with the key below.

API key for yahig-tadup: kto7_ubizbYm

## Account Recovery — Fanout Backpressure Console

If the Heraldic notification fan-out starts shedding load, someone usually needs to bump the backpressure thresholds from the ops console. Problem: the console account locks after three bad logins, which happens roughly every other incident. Recovery is self-serve — hit the reset flow, answer the challenge, and you're back in. The challenge expects the team recovery passphrase, which for on-call convenience is written just below.

vault phrase of hahop-badug = novvan-ulaion-zorius-noviel-gorwyn-casix-tamys